JavaScript是一种广泛使用的脚本语言,用于为网页添加交互性和动态功能。作为一名新手,学习JavaScript可以让你更好地理解网页的开发和设计,并为你的技能增添一项有价值的技能。在本指南中,我们将为你提供一些基础的JavaScript知识,帮助你快速入门。
目录
- JavaScript的基本概念
- 在HTML中使用JavaScript
- 变量和数据类型
- 运算符
- 条件语句
- 循环语句
- 函数
- 数组和对象
- JavaScript库和框架
- 资源推荐
JavaScript的基本概念
JavaScript是一种解释型的脚本语言,它主要用于在网页中添加交互性和动态功能。它可以在浏览器中直接运行,无需编译,使得网页更加生动和有趣。
在HTML中使用JavaScript
要在HTML文件中使用JavaScript代码,可以使用<script>标签将代码嵌入到HTML文件中。<script>标签可以放在<head>元素内或<body>元素内。例如:
<!DOCTYPE html>
<html>
<head>
<script>
// 在这里编写你的JavaScript代码
</script>
</head>
<body>
<!-- HTML内容 -->
</body>
</html>
变量和数据类型
JavaScript中的变量用于存储数据。变量必须先声明后使用。JavaScript中的数据类型包括字符串(string)、数字(number)、布尔值(boolean)、对象(object)、数组(array)等等。
// 声明变量并赋值
let name = "John";
let age = 25;
let isStudent = true;
// 输出变量值
console.log(name);
console.log(age);
console.log(isStudent);
运算符
JavaScript提供了一系列的运算符用于执行各种操作。常见的运算符包括算术运算符、赋值运算符、比较运算符等。
let x = 10;
let y = 5;
console.log(x + y); // 加法运算
console.log(x - y); // 减法运算
console.log(x * y); // 乘法运算
console.log(x / y); // 除法运算
console.log(x % y); // 取模运算
console.log(x > y); // 大于运算
console.log(x === y); // 等于运算
条件语句
条件语句可以根据给定的条件执行不同的操作。常见的条件语句包括if语句和switch语句。
let age = 18;
if (age < 18) {
console.log("未成年");
} else if (age >= 18 && age < 60) {
console.log("成年人");
} else {
console.log("老年人");
}
循环语句
循环语句用于重复执行一段代码。常见的循环语句有for循环和while循环。
for (let i = 1; i <= 5; i++) {
console.log(i);
}
let i = 1;
while (i <= 5) {
console.log(i);
i++;
}
函数
函数是一段可重复使用的代码块。它可以接收参数并返回一个值。通过函数,你可以将一段代码封装起来,并在需要的时候进行调用。
function square(x) {
return x * x;
}
console.log(square(5)); // 输出 25
数组和对象
数组和对象是JavaScript中的两种复杂数据类型。数组用于存储一组有序的值,而对象用于存储一组键值对。你可以通过索引来访问数组中的元素,通过属性名来访问对象中的属性。
let fruits = ["apple", "banana", "orange"];
console.log(fruits[0]); // 输出 "apple"
let person = {
name: "John",
age: 25,
isStudent: true
};
console.log(person.name); // 输出 "John"
JavaScript库和框架
JavaScript库和框架是用于简化JavaScript开发的工具。常见的JavaScript库包括jQuery、Lodash等,它们提供了大量的实用工具和函数;而框架如React、Vue等则用于构建复杂的Web应用。
资源推荐
- MDN Web 文档:MDN提供了全面而易懂的JavaScript文档,适合初学者查阅。
- W3School JavaScript教程:W3School提供了丰富的在线教程,适合进行实践和练习。
- JavaScript 菜鸟教程:菜鸟教程提供了JavaScript的基础知识和实例讲解,适合新手入门。
希望本指南能帮助你快速入门JavaScript,并为你在网页开发的旅程中提供一些基础知识。祝愿你学得愉快!
本文来自极简博客,作者:技术探索者,转载请注明原文链接:JavaScript新手入门指南
微信扫一扫,打赏作者吧~